Give me a call, I can give you a few pointers with the set up. The 06 Triton should have come with a jack plate. It is a must on a Tr-196 to achieve proper set up and a 8" plate is better than a 6". A tr-196 properly set up should run with a 200 opti around 67-72 mph. Your motor is most likely way to low on the transom causing both the extreme walk and slow speeds. ive got 04 196 with 200 opti. i run 73mph GPS. my current setup is 6" plate, holeshot plate, 26 tempest (all 3 plugs are small size). they do take a bit to learn how to drive. my walks starting about 60-62mph but i've learned to drive it. i run my plate about 5.25" above. mine came with 25p but i hit rev limiter too easy. so Matt at Plapps swapped me to a 26 but think i need to contact him again cause i'm still having probs hitting limiter. good luck and hope you get it figured out. feel free to contact me if you have any questions.
